Since its initial release in 2019, Disney Tsum Tsum Festival has stood out as a unique entry in the roster of Nintendo Switch party games. Developed by B.B. Studio and Hyde and published by Bandai Namco Entertainment, it marked the first time the popular "Tsum Tsum" toy line—featuring squishy, stackable versions of iconic Disney and Pixar characters—received a full console adaptation. The game is set within a vibrant toy store where players can engage in ten different party games, including curling, hockey, air hockey, ice cream stacking, and rhythm games. It also includes a faithful adaptation of the classic Tsum Tsum mobile puzzle game, playable in vertical mode using the Switch's touchscreen.
